| Whether
you live in a city, small town, suburb, or rural community,
access to jobs, shopping, and services is probably important
to you. The economic health of your community may also weigh
on your mind.
Smart
Growth takes a unique approach to economic development-literally-by
building on the unique assets of communities. There is no
single formula for successful economic development, but by
directing State resource to revitalize establish communities
and equip them with infrastructure sufficient to support business
growth, Maryland is building a foundation for economic growth
and long-term investment.
